MAKE THE PROCESS EASY

People hate jumping through hoops to get what they want. Why make the rental process confusing, cumbersome and annoying?

Let me phrase this another way. Let’s say you don’t currently have access to an indoor gymnasium and you need to find space to run team practices.

Facility 1 indicates that they do offer athletic space rentals (YAY!) but you have no idea what days are available, what times are available, there are no pictures so you don’t know if it’s a hardwood court, rubber court, how many hoops it has, parent seating etc. As they request on the website, you call and no one picks up. You leave a voicemail in their general mailbox and as an added step you email the contact listed on the page.

Facility 2 indicates they also offer athletic space rentals (YAY!). They utilize a service that allows you to see each individual space (multiple pictures of each at that!), amenities, reviews of previous renters who have used the space (all 5 stars! WOW!) and more. You also have the ability to enter the dates and times you’re looking for and can see instantly if those times are available. To your delight, they are! This facility even allows you to complete the rental agreement digitally, attach required documents in the comfort of my own bean bag chair and complete payment. Just like that you’re done (now you can catch up on This Is Us!). Request is in and accepted minutes later by the facility. Wow! That was easy…..and now this facility has your business for years.

Facility 1 responds back 5 days later, but now it’s too late. I’ve already found my place and won’t be in the market to find an additional space for quite a while. If I do, I’ll just rent more from the place who provided the best rental experience.

Take home message- Make the process EASY for your renters. As a double whammy, this also results in making the process much easier for you and your team.

PROVIDE ADD-ON OPTIONS FOR MORE MEMORABLE EXPERIENCE

“In order to be irreplaceable one must always be different” — Coco Chanel

Each year, millions of parents are trying to plan a memorable birthday party or experience for their children. Many of which are hosted at facilities. However, once the space is booked, they’re still left with having to manage other additional purchases to make that birthday experience special.

Each year, tournament organizations across the country are looking for new spaces to rent for tournaments, but spend additional time and resources to find and hire “Scorekeepers”, “clock operators” or “referees”.

The list goes on and on. Most facilities don’t even consider or offer “Add-on” options for renters requesting to utilize the space. Let’s see how this can create a massive win for your facility.

Lets say I work for a hospital, oversee employee health initiatives and I want to create an adult basketball league for our employees. I have NO idea what to do to get started. This is a new service we’re looking to offer to attract more employees, provide them with an outlet to stay healthy and connect with their peers.

I’m browsing an athletic space directory such as AthletiCalendar and see several courts and stumble upon your basketball court. I see you have options for me to “Add-on” to my rental request. I haven’t seen this on any website or rental process before….. I’m intrigued to say the least.

I see an option to “Add-On” referees (SWEET, I’d have no idea how to find them otherwise), “Add-On” for a scoreboard operator (JACKPOT!), “Add-On” for uniforms (ARE YOU KIDDING ME!). As a facility you’ve completely helped me streamline the organization of this entire league and for that, I’ll never look anywhere else again.

The “Add-On’s” can be customized based off what you are willing to offer. Some platforms such as AthletiCalendar may also be able to offer “universal” add-on’s (such as referees) to assist with this offering to your customers.

The bigger picture is not only did you land a fantastic renter, but your $75/hour rent, just increased significantly due to your “Add-on” options.

Take Home Message- Provide an unforgettable experience for your renters by providing “add-on” options, which save them time and money and gain a customer for life.
